Definition
- 1Dated form of purr (“low murmuring sound as of a cat”).
Recorded use
Wiktionary exampleThese source excerpts show how pur appears in context. They illustrate usage; the definition above remains the entry’s reference meaning.
The first — called by Laennec, from its resemblance to the pur of a cat, the purring tremor — is nearly always indicative of a valvular lesion. The second is caused by the to-and-fro motion of a roughened pericardium.
